Yozuri Crystal Minnow Long Cast 70mm / 90mm / 110mm / 130mm Sinking F948 / F949 / F950 / F951
The Crystal Minnow Long Cast is the distance-focused version of the Crystal Minnow: a slim sinking body with an internal weight system that shifts rearward on the cast so the lure flies nose-first instead of helicoptering. That matters when you are casting off a beach, breakwall or rock platform into wind and the fish sit beyond comfortable range. Because it sinks, the same lure covers the top metre on a fast retrieve or drops into a gutter on a count-down. Four sizes run from 70mm and 9g for light estuary tackle up to 130mm and 29g for surf and offshore casting.

How To Fish It
- Count down to the layer — Cast, then count the lure down before winding. A one or two count keeps it just under the surface; a longer count puts it in a gutter or over a drop-off. Repeat the count that produces fish.
- Steady swim — A medium unbroken retrieve keeps the wobble running true. Best starting retrieve at dawn, dusk and in coloured water.
- Twitch and pause — Two or three taps of the rod tip, then stop and let it sink level. The dart-then-drop sequence triggers followers that will not eat a straight retrieve.
- Work the wash and tide line — Cast past a breaking bank, rock wash or current seam and bring the lure through the turbulence into the calm water behind it.
- Match size to the target — 70mm and 90mm for estuary and light shore work, 110mm for general surf and jetty fishing, 130mm for big baitfish or maximum distance.
Target Species By Region
- Southeast Asia — Hampala barb (sebarau) on the small sizes in reservoir arms, barramundi (siakap) and mangrove jack around jetties and rock walls, queenfish (talang), barracuda and Spanish mackerel (tenggiri) on the larger sizes.
- North America — Smallmouth and largemouth bass, trout and white bass on 70mm and 90mm; striped bass, bluefish, redfish and speckled trout on 110mm and 130mm.
- Japan & East Asia — Japanese seabass (suzuki) from breakwaters and river mouths, trout and blackbass on the small sizes, and hirame and kochi from surf beaches on the larger ones.
- Australia, Middle East & Europe — Bream, flathead and Australian bass in estuaries, tailor and salmon off the beaches; queenfish and barracuda on Gulf coasts; sea bass, bluefish, perch, zander and pike across Europe.
Specifications
| Model | Length | Weight | Type | Hooks | Running Depth | SKU Prefix |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| F948 | 70mm | 9g | Sinking | 2 x #10 treble | 0.3–0.8 m | 31F948 |
| F949 | 90mm | 11g | Sinking | 2 x #8 treble | 0.3–0.8 m | 31F949 |
| F950 | 110mm | 17g | Sinking | Treble | Not published | 31F950 |
| F951 | 130mm | 29g | Sinking | Treble | Not published | 31F951 |
Available colours: BHS, CIW, HGR, HRIW, KBLS, LSCA. HGR is offered on 90mm, 110mm and 130mm only. Running depth on 110mm and 130mm is not published by the manufacturer; set depth by count-down and retrieve speed.
Recommended Pairing
- 70mm / 90mm: light spinning rod rated 5–20g, 2500 reel, PE 0.6–1.0, 12–20 lb fluorocarbon leader
- 110mm: 7'–9' shore rod rated 10–30g, 3000 reel, PE 1.0–1.5, 20–30 lb leader
- 130mm: 9'–10' surf or rock rod rated 15–45g, 4000 reel, PE 1.5–2.0, 30–40 lb leader
- Add a short knottable wire trace where mackerel and barracuda are present
